1/29/2025

Best Practices for WordPress Security: Protecting Your Site from Threats

WordPress is a fantastic platform powering roughly 43% of all websites on the internet, making it a prime target for hackers & malicious actors. The ever-evolving landscape of cyber threats has made it imperative for website owners to prioritize the security of their WordPress sites. In this blog, we're going to explore various best practices to fortify your WordPress security & keep your site safe from threats.

Understanding Why WordPress is Targeted

Before diving into security best practices, it's essential to understand why WordPress sites are often susceptible to attacks. One significant reason is that its popularity offers hackers a broad target; if they find a vulnerability, many websites could fall victim to it. Hackers typically exploit WordPress sites to:
  • Steal sensitive information: This could be anything from user data to credit card details.
  • Distribute malware or spam: Once they gain access, attackers may use your site to send spam emails or install malware on user devices.
  • DDoS attacks: The attackers may attempt to disrupt service by overwhelming your server.
Knowing this, it’s crucial to adopt a proactive approach. Let’s jump into some effective strategies to protect your WordPress site!

1. Keep Everything Up-to-Date

One of the most fundamental measures you can take is ensuring that your WordPress core, themes, & plugins are always up-to-date. Outdated software is a common entry point for hackers. Check out the steps:
  • WordPress Core Updates: The WordPress team frequently releases updates that fix bugs & vulnerabilities. Regularly check Dashboard > Updates in your WordPress admin area to apply updates promptly.
  • Themes & Plugins: Many hackers exploit outdated plugins or themes. Make it a habit to audit them regularly. Consider using a managed WordPress hosting provider that can automatically perform these updates.
Keeping Everything Updated

2. Use Strong Password Practices

You can’t have a good security strategy without STRONG passwords. Many brute-force attacks are successful because of weak passwords. Start condition your users to use:
  • Unique, complex passwords that combine upper & lower case letters, numbers, & symbols. Try tools like 1Password or LastPass for generating & storing strong passwords.
  • Avoiding common usernames like ā€œadmin.ā€ Try to utilize less obvious usernames and eliminate the default accounts.

3. Limit Login Attempts

By default, WordPress allows an unlimited number of login attempts. This can be vulnerable to brute-force attacks. To combat this, consider limiting login attempts using a plugin like Limit Login Attempts Reloaded.
This tool will block access for a specified time after a user reaches a certain number of failed login attempts, effectively reducing risks.

4. Implement Two-Factor Authentication (2FA)

Adding an extra layer of security is always a great idea! Two-Factor Authentication requires users to input a second form of identification, usually a code sent to their mobile device or email. You can set this up using plugins like Google Authenticator or as a feature in many security plugins.

5. Install Security Plugins

While WordPress has some built-in security features, deploying dedicated security plugins can significantly bolster your protection. Here are a few favorites:
  • Sucuri Security
    • A comprehensive security plugin offering malware scanning, security activity auditing, & hardening options.
  • Wordfence
    • Provides robust firewall & malware scanner capabilities.
  • iThemes Security
    • Offers a suite of essential security measures.
      Using one or more of these plugins can keep you ahead of potential threats.

6. Backup Your Website Regularly

Never underestimate the importance of backups! In case something goes south, having backups will save your day. Use reliable backup solutions like UpdraftPlus or VaultPress to set up automatic backups. Store those backups off-site (e.g., Dropbox or Amazon S3) for additional security.

7. Secure the wp-admin Directory

The wp-admin area is a primary target for attackers. Here are several steps you can take:
  • Change the default login URL using plugins like WPS Hide Login to make it less predictable.
  • Password protect the wp-admin directory, adding an additional layer of security via cPanel or through FTP.
  • Limit user access to wp-admin. Assign roles based on necessity & remove those who don’t require admin-level access.

8. Use HTTPS to Encrypt Your Data

Switching to HTTPS isn’t just a recommendation but a necessity! It helps encrypt any data transferred between your server & your users. You can obtain an SSL certificate for free via Let’s Encrypt or through many hosting providers, including WP Engine.
Once this is set up, you shouldn’t just talk the talk; make it a habit to enforce HTTPS throughout your site.

9. Regular Security Scans

Incorporate regular security scans with plugins like Sucuri or find a managed hosting solution that monitors your site's security. Routinely review the audit logs—keeping an eye on your website's activities can help detect any irregularities or unauthorized changes.

10. Educate Yourself & Your Users

Lastly, information is your best ally. Keep yourself educated & stay aware of the latest trends in WordPress security. Educate your users as well, encouraging them to follow security best practices. Consider creating a simple security policy that outlines effective safe usage behavior.

Conclusion

Securing your WordPress site is an ongoing effort that requires consistent diligence across various aspects. By applying these best practices—from keeping everything updated to regularly backing up your site—you can significantly minimize the risks your site could face.
As a final tip, consider using Arsturn to harness the power of AI for engagements. Arsturn's easy-to-use chatbot platform allows you to create customized chatbots for your site, strengthening your audience engagement & boosting conversions. Whether you're looking to serve better customer queries or simply improve site interaction, give Arsturn a try today!
With WordPress, security isn’t just about implementing tools & solutions; it's also about adopting a security-first mindset that emphasizes vigilance against potential threats. Remember, the best defense is a good offense—stay one step ahead of attackers, & you'll keep your WordPress site secure!

Arsturn.com/
Claim your chatbot

Copyright Ā© ArsturnĀ 2025